Help Max McGillivray Represent Australia at the 2025 ISA World Junior Surfing Championships.
At just 16 years old, Max McGillivray from the Northern NSW coast has achieved something truly incredible — he’s been selected to represent Australia at the 2025 ISA World Junior Surfing Championships.
Max may not be local but his family certainly is. Katrina Davey, Max's mum, along with her siblings Ben & Clare were all born and bred in Seymour. There wouldn't be too many that have not heard the Davey name around town. A likeable family who also are committed to local sporting groups and giving back to the community.
It’s a massive moment for Max, who was once nervous about even getting on a board. It wasn’t until around the age of 10 that he really felt comfortable in the ocean — and since then, he hasn’t looked back. His passion, perseverance, and dedication to the sport have seen him rise through the ranks, and now he has the chance to compete on the world stage.
